The Bautista Red Cross Youth Council (BRCYC) of Bautista National High School is composed of students whose age ranges from 13 to 17 years old. Its mission is to educate and empower the children and youth in the spirit of Red Cross through constructive trainings and effective leadership and provide opportunities for directing and harnessing their energy and idealism into worthwhile humanitarian activities. Its four major objectives are: (1) Inculcation of Humanitarian Values - the organization that the early development of humanitarian leaders lies in the inculcation of humanitarian values among its youth members. (2) Instill the Practice of Healthy Lifestyle - build a healthy community through youth participation and involvement in health promotion and education towards a stronger nation. (3) Enhance Youth Leadership Skills through Service Delivery - to be active in community development by leading the delivery of Red Cross services in their capacity as volunteers. (4) Advocate of National/International Friendship - to promote camaraderie and unity, mutual respect and the spirit of international brotherhood amidst socio-cultural diversity. Its role and engagement in the humanitarian work of the Philippine Red Cross provides them an area to realize their potential in humanitarian leadership.
